Playing With Colors - Crayola Madness

By Office Bull at 04/26/08 20:18

, Colors: Funny Crayola Colors

When we were still kids, we roam around the house armed with our crayolas, sometimes paintbrushes, and start painting and applying vandals on the walls. Then in a few minutes, we will hear our mommies screaming "What did you do to the wall!?!"

If you could remember that part of your life, I bet you're laughing by now. Kids are hilarious. What we do in our childhood is simply priceless, we do things for fun and not for anything else. No hidden agendas yet, lol.

But if you have a set of colors like the ones in the photo, I guess you don't have to paint and color your houses walls to have fun, because each color name itself is funny. Flu Phlegm Green (yummy! haha), Mcdonald's Burger Gray (ok, do we have to rub in that they're burgers are gray? lol), Found In Diaper Gold (now thats just disgusting), Time O'The MOnth Red (eeww) and a lot more.

When I was a kid I used to put my crayons, and even the crayons from my mom's office, under the sun. And when they are already there for like 3-5 hours, you can see them starting to melt, and the color that they will produce is spectacular. They are like candles that were melted only that they have different colors.

I also used them to make illustrations of whatever I see. If our family goes on a travel, I stayed awake for the duration of the ride because I love looking at the sceneries. Then I would draw them using my crayons and some old bond papers. Hey, I was not allowed to use anything other than old papers and crayons because according to them, when I was a kid I used to pricked my playmates with pencils and pens so they instead gave me a crayon. And only old papers for me so they will not go to waste and have a pile of junk papers in our house. I'm not good at using the coloring book because I just rip them off, lol!

Kids life is always as colorful as the crayons we are fond of playing with. So one day try doing what you used to do. Color your walls now. Ha ha.
